Bill Summary

AN ACT to amend 347.25 (3) of the statutes; relating to: authorized lights for funeral procession vehicles.

AI Summary

This bill amends Wisconsin state law regarding authorized lights for vehicles in funeral processions by allowing the lead vehicle (or all vehicles in the procession if uniformly equipped) to use either a flashing amber light or a new option of a flashing purple light during the funeral procession. The proposed change expands the existing law that previously only permitted flashing amber lights, adding purple as an additional authorized color for these special vehicle lights. The bill is a focused, narrow amendment to section 347.25(3) of the Wisconsin statutes, which governs vehicle lighting during funeral processions. By introducing purple as an alternative to amber, the bill provides funeral procession organizers with more flexibility in signaling and identifying vehicles participating in the procession, potentially improving visibility and helping other drivers recognize and respect the funeral procession.
